Abstract
Hawaiʻi is one of the most racially and ethnically diverse states in the US. Such a population profile often complicates race/ethnicity categorizations when data are prepared for analysis. The Hawaii population also includes a high proportion of mixed-race individuals. Categorization for those individuals is another challenge in data preparation. This presentation will discuss the challenge of working with data from racially/ethnically diverse communities and resources for categories and population size estimates for racial/ethnic groups, including the Biostatistics Core Hawai‘i Single-Race Categorization Tool.
